Self-activated assessments in some courses
"new releases for both Introduction to IoT and Introduction to the Internet of Everything courses (in all languages) which include enhancements based on instructor feedback to automatically activate assessments and course completion, minimizing instructor efforts."
Question: May I "deactivate" this new (useless) feature and be again the one who decides when my students should take exams?

Thank you for the feedback. Self-paced courses, such as Introduction to Technology will have assessments automatically activated. These assessments are exactly the same ones that are available on the courses on NetAcad.com, i.e. the answers are already available to the students. Because of this the decision was based on instructor feedback to automatically activate assessments and course completion, thus minimizing instructor efforts.
Instructors who want to control the assessment timeline in their classrooms always have the ability to un-publish these assessments, edit the assignments to have due dates or create specific dates for students to take the assessment. In addition Instructors can create their own quizzes.
